Do you ever feel like you’re not growing fast enough—or that you’ll never fully change?

In this powerful episode of Kingdom Now with Dr. John Carmichael, discover the confidence every believer can have: if God started a work in you, He will finish it. Rooted in Philippians 1:6, this message reveals that your growth is not just about your effort—it’s about God’s faithfulness from beginning to completion.

You’ll learn how to:
• Trust God as the author and finisher of your faith
• Recognize that God is actively working in you right now
• Stay faithful in the process of spiritual growth
• Overcome discouragement when progress feels slow
• Live with confidence that your story ends in victory, not failure

This message will encourage you to stop striving, start trusting, and remain consistent as God completes the work He began in your life.
